In 1992, some of the fastest American cars included the Chevrolet Corvette ZR-1, which featured a 375-horsepower LT5 engine and could reach 0-60 mph in around 4.5 seconds. The Dodge Viper, while not yet widely available, was in its prototype stage and promised high performance with its powerful V10 engine. The Ford Mustang SVT Cobra was also notable, offering enhanced performance with a powerful V8 engine. These cars showcased American engineering prowess in the early '90s.
